Rear Parking Assist system

malfunction

If no distance segments illuminate and no
acoustic warning sounds, there is a
malfunction in the Rear Parking Assist
system.

X

Have the Rear Parking Assist system
checked at an authorized Mercedes-Benz
Center as soon as possible.

Rear view camera

The rear view camera is an optical parking aid.
The area behind the vehicle appears in the
COMAND system display as a mirror image,
like in the rear view mirror.

G

Warning!

Make sure no persons or animals are in or
near the area in which you are parking/
maneuvering. Otherwise, they could be
injured.

G

Warning!

The rear view camera is only an aid and may
display obstacles

R

from a distorted perspective

R

inaccurately

R

may not display obstacles at all

The rear view camera does not relieve you of
the responsibility to be cautious. Take care
and pay careful attention. The rear view
camera may not show objects which are

R

very close to the rear bumper

R

under the rear bumper

R

under the spare wheel

R

nearby behind the spare wheel

You are responsible for safety at all times and
must continue to pay attention to the
immediate surroundings when parking and
maneuvering. This includes the area behind,

in front of, and beside the vehicle. Otherwise
you could endanger yourself and/or others.

G

Warning!

The rear view camera either will not function
or will not function to its full capability if

R

the tailgate is open

R

it is raining very hard, snowing or foggy

R

it is night or you are parking/maneuvering
your vehicle in an area where it is very dark

R

the camera is exposed to a very bright white
light

R

the immediate surroundings are
illuminated with fluorescent light (the
display may flicker)

R

there is a sudden change in temperature,
e.g. if you drive into a heated garage from
the cold (lens condensation)

R

the camera lens is dirty or covered

R

the rear of your vehicle is damaged
In this case, have the position and setting
of the camera checked by a qualified
specialist workshop. Mercedes-Benz
recommends that you contact a Mercedes-
Benz Center for this purpose.

Do not use the rear view camera in these
situations. Otherwise you could injure
yourself or others and/or damage property
including your vehicle while parking/
maneuvering.
